Результаты поиска по запросу "oracle"

1 ответ

Динамический SQL LOOP

Динамический SQL не мой друг, в основном идея заключается в том, что я могу использовать процедуру с параметром "p_in_table", чтобы получить количество строк, содержащихся в таблице. CREATE OR REPLACE PROCEDURE how_many_rows(p_in_table VARCHAR2) ...

4 ответа

Как обновить один столбец, используя другой столбец в другой таблице? Ошибка SQL: ORA-00933: команда SQL неправильно завершена

Я перепробовал все, что могу придумать, но не смог решить эту ошибку SQL: Ошибка SQL: ORA-00933: команда SQL неправильно завершена Это Oracle SQL. UPDATE SALES_DATA_FAMILY_2007 A SET A.POG_ID=B.POG_ID FROM POG_HIERARCHY B ...

1 ответ

Есть ли другой способ создания ограничений при создании таблицы SQL?

Предположим, у меня есть следующие SQL-операторы с использованием Oracle: drop table department cascade constraints; drop table facultyStaff cascade constraints; drop table student cascade constraints; drop table campusClub cascade constraints; ...

ТОП публикаций

2 ответа

Oracle: несколько обновлений таблицы => ORA-01779: невозможно изменить столбец, который сопоставляется с таблицей без сохранения ключа

Я сделал соединение между таблицами. Я просто хочу взять значения из некоторых данных и поместить в другие столбцы. Но это не работает. Как я мог переписать запрос? Я хочу перезаписать значения в таблице wkfc со значениями из swkf. Я знаю, что ...

3 ответа

ORA-00907 Отсутствует правильная проблема с круглыми скобками - выберите с заказом внутри запроса вставки

Я пытаюсь сделать вставку в таблицу, и он использует один оператор выбора для одного столбца. Ниже приведена иллюстрация моего запроса. INSERT INTO MY_TBL (MY_COL1, MY_COL2) VALUES ( (SELECT DATA FROM FIR_TABL WHERE ID = 1 AND ROWNUM = 1 ORDER ...

2 ответа

Oracle SQL - Использование объединений для поиска значений в одной таблице, а не в другой

Поскольку, очевидно, все ненавидят суб-выборки, я хотел бы сделать это, используя соединения Для невероятно надуманного примера возьмем две таблицы: одну со списком чисел от 1 до 6 и одну со списком четных чисел от 0 до 8. Тогда моей целью было ...

5 ответов

Как создать и использовать временную таблицу в хранимой процедуре Oracle?

Я хочу создать временную таблицу в хранимой процедуре и получить к ней доступ, но я получил ошибку,ORA-00942:Table or view does not exists. Ниже приведена процедура, которую я пытался, Create procedure myproc IS stmt varchar2(1000); BEGIN ...

3 ответа

Как я могу эффективно запрашивать непрерывные наборы дат в моем наборе данных?

site_id | start_date | end_date 1 | oct 1, 08 | oct 2, 08 1 | oct 2, 08 | oct 3, 08 ... 1 | oct 30, 08 | oct 31, 08 2 | oct 1, 08 | oct 2, 08 2 | oct 2, 08 | oct 3, 08 ... 2 | oct 30, 08 | oct 31, 08У меня есть таблица, которая содержит 1 запись ...

2 ответа

Пытаясь понять over () и разделить

Я пытаюсь перебрать и разделить по функциональности, обернутой вокруг моей головы. Вот пример, который я просто не понимаю. Вот данные, которые у меня есть: SALESORDERID ORDERDATE 43894 08/01/2001 43664 07/01/2001 43911 08/01/2001 ...

5 ответов

Как создать новую базу данных после первоначальной установки базы данных Oracle 11g Express Edition?

Я установил Oracle Database 11g Expressed Edition на свой компьютер (Windows 7) и также установил Oracle SQL Developer. Я хочу начать с простой базы данных, может быть, с одной или двух таблиц, а затем использовать Oracle SQL Developer для ...